2 cancer cells biotechs combine, producing global impact

.OncoC4 is taking AcroImmune-- as well as its own internal professional production capabilities-- under its wing in an all-stock merger.Each cancer biotechs were actually co-founded by OncoC4 chief executive officer Yang Liu, Ph.D., as well as OncoC4 Chief Medical Police Officer Frying Pan Zheng, M.D., Ph.D, according to a Sept. 25 launch.OncoC4 is a spinout from Liu- as well as Zheng-founded OncoImmune, which was actually acquired in 2020 through Merck &amp Co. for $425 million. Right now, the personal, Maryland-based biotech is actually getting one hundred% of all AcroImmune's exceptional equity interests. The business possess an identical investor bottom, depending on to the release.
The new biotech are going to work under OncoC4's name and also are going to remain to be led by chief executive officer Liu. Certain financials of the bargain were actually not made known.The merging includes AI-081, a preclinical bispecific antitoxin targeting PD-1 and also VEGF, to OncoC4's pipeline. The AcroImmune possession is actually prepped for an investigational brand-new drug (IND) declaring, with the submitting anticipated in the last quarter of this particular year, according to the business.AI-081 could expand checkpoint treatment's prospective all over cancers cells, CMO Zheng mentioned in the release.OncoC4 additionally gets AI-071, a period 2-ready siglec agonist that is actually set to be studied in an acute respiratory failure test and also an immune-related unpleasant introductions study. The unique natural immune gate was actually found out by the OncoC4 co-founders and also is actually developed for broad request in both cancer cells as well as extreme irritation.The merging additionally increases OncoC4's geographic impact with internal professional manufacturing functionalities in China, depending on to Liu.." Collectively, these harmonies even more boost the capacity of OncoC4 to supply varied as well as unique immunotherapies extending numerous methods for challenging to manage strong lumps and also hematological malignancies," Liu claimed in the release.OncoC4 already promotes a siglec course, referred to ONC-841, which is actually a monoclonal antibody (mAb) designed that just entered phase 1 screening. The firm's preclinical resources include a CAR-T tissue therapy, a bispecific mAb and ADC..The biotech's latest-stage program is gotistobart, a next-gen anti-CTLA-4 antibody prospect in shared growth with BioNTech. In March 2023, BioNTech compensated $ 200 thousand beforehand for progression and business civil liberties to the CTLA-4 possibility, which is presently in phase 3 growth for immunotherapy-resistant non-small tissue lung cancer..
